Via 由 [ ] 提供

封装 Encapsulation

  • 使一个类的变量 private
  • 提供 public 方法来调用这些变量. 所以外部类是进不去的. 这些变量被隐藏在类里了. 只能通过已经定义的 pulic 方法调用.

好处

当我们修改我们的实现的代码时, 不会破坏其他调用我们这部分代码的代码. 可维护性, 灵活性和可扩展